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90507137091 14191 78 739434
913763 827 484597
913763 827 484597
610007966 84 829 13415155
All about undefined
Interested in learning more?
913763 827 484597
610007966 84 829 13415155
See more
35208005 822 62260024
185566812 98198013 73 032818764
See more
1480543591 41 4313
49332 026856 0333893
See more